News24's investigative team was honoured for its contribution to justice by using its platform to shine a spotlight on the targeted killings of whistleblowers and raising awareness of the dangers faced by those who expose corruption, at the 2024 Whistleblowers Awards on Wednesday ...

Apr 8, 2020 · Accountability is critical at National Aids Council, says new civil society leader. The South African National Aids Council is meant to play a co-ordinating role in the country’s response to HIV, bringing government, civil society, and other stakeholders together under one roof.
